Prospero Teaching is seeking a Daily Supply SEN Teaching Assistant to support pupils with additional learning needs across Havering. This role suits both experienced assistants and psychology graduates seeking flexible, term-time opportunities.

You will work one-to-one and in small groups, helping children with ASD, ADHD, SEMH, and other communication needs, under the guidance of teaching staff. DBS enhanced required or willing to obtain Update Service.
